Brief Summary
The purpose of this study is to evaluate the potential interaction between metformin and exercise in order to optimize clinical guidelines for treatment of T2D.

Outcome Measures
Primary Outcomes (1)
Overall aerobic work performed during an exercise bout with self-selected intensity
Total oxygen consumption (L O2) during a 45 min ergometer cycling bout with self-selected intensity
Secondary Outcomes (6)
External work performed during an exercise bout with self-selected intensity
Total work produced (kJ) during a 45 min ergometer cycling bout with self-selected intensity
Rate of perceived exertion during an exercise bout with fixed intensity
Mean rate of perceived exertion (Borg scale) during a 45 min ergometer cycling bout with fixed intensity
blood lactate during an exercise bout with fixed intensity
Mean blood lactate (mmol/l) during a 45 min ergometer cycling bout with fixed intensity
Heartrate during an exercise bout with fixed intensity
Mean heart rate (bpm) during a 45 min ergometer cycling bout with fixed intensity
Respiratory exchange ratio during an exercise bout with fixed intensity
Mean VCO2/VO2 during a 45 min ergometer cycling bout with fixed intensity

Eligibility Criteria
You may qualify if:
- male
- HbA1c \< 39 mmol/l
- BMI \< 25
- structured physical activity \< = 150 min/week
- apparently healthy
You may not qualify if:
- smoking
- daily pharmaceutical treatment
- contraindication to increased levels of physical activity
- ALAT/ASAT elevated 3 times above upper normal values
- renal insufficiency (eGFR \< 60 ml/min)
- prior history of lactic acidosis
